Types of Boiler Machines

The classification of boilers is primarily based on their operation and structure. The three predominant types are combination boilers, conventional boilers, and system boilers. Combination boilers offer on-demand hot water without the need for a storage tank, making them a compact and convenient solution for limited spaces. Conventional boilers, equipped with both hot and cold water storage tanks, are suited for homes with higher water usage. Lastly, system boilers are akin to conventional boilers in terms of high water demand accommodation but do not require a cold water tank, simplifying installation and maintenance.

Features and Materials of Boiler Machines

The features of a boiler can significantly impact its performance and longevity. Advanced boiler equipment may include features like modulating burners, which adjust the burner's output to match the heat demand, thereby enhancing efficiency. The materials used in boiler construction, such as stainless steel or cast iron, also play a vital role in the durability and heat conduction properties of the unit.
